Purpose:
The Programs Director helps guide intervention design by providing oversight, and program leadership for core initiatives. Ensure that programs remain in accord with the organization's mission, are health-informed, community-relevant, and grounded in public health principles.
Responsibilities:
- Maintain knowledge of the organization and personal commitment to its goals and objectives
- Provide oversight and guidance on educational and health programming
- Help strengthen the quality, relevance, and public-health value of Human Biology® programming.
- Advise on curriculum direction, program integrity, and appropriate health-centered standards
- Support development of mission-aligned interventions that reflect preventive wellness goals
- Develop partnerships with clinicians, dietitians, educators, and public health professionals
- Offer informed input on program design, implementation, evaluation, and improvement
- Support the organization in maintaining responsible, and evidence-informed messaging
- Align programming with organizational priorities by scaling community impact goals
Length of term: Two years
Time Commitment: As required to accomplish major duties
Reporting: The Programs Director reports to the Board Chair and to the Board of Trustees
Knowledge and Skills:
- Knowledge of the organization and personal commitment to its goals and objectives
- Strong understanding of preventive health, nutrition education, community wellness, or plant-based health programming
- Understanding of community health education and practical approaches to disease prevention
- Commitment to improving social determinants of health outcomes through accessible, responsible, and mission-driven programming
- Preferred Background: MD, DO, RD, RDN, RN, CNS, DPH, MPH, PA, NP, BSPH.
